Kate’s counselling experience spans over 28+ years and specialises in trauma-informed individual counselling and clinical supervision. Kate is passionate about applying trauma-informed practices to promote the safety and empowerment of choice and decision-making for all clients. Providing relevant education, practical strategies and coping tools is essential for wellbeing, self-awareness, reflection, and understanding. Kate enables clients to experience hope and curiosity toward their wellbeing and counselling goals. Kate also provides supervision. Kate listens with a compassionate heart and brings along warmth, humour and wisdom.
Kate offers a person-centred approach using evidenced-based frameworks and theoretical strategies • Trauma-Informed Therapy: Healing from trauma • EMDR • Somatic Work: Involving the body in healing from trauma symptoms • Cognitive Emotional Behavioral Therapy (CEBT) • Mindfulness-Based Therapy • Psychodynamic Therapy • Family Systems Model • Strengths-based
Kate works with adults, adolescents and LGBTQ+ individuals with relationship, trauma C/PTSD, anxiety, depression, guilt and grief. With her Master of Vocational Rehabilitation Counselling, Kate can also provide support for WorkCover and Veteran clients to support workplace psychological/physical injuries and return to work options. Kate is an EAP provider.
